How many pumps are you using? And, if you're doing a double cleanse, you are dividing that recommended number of pumps by two, and using half for the first cleanse and half for your second cleanse, right?

For me, I apply what I think I need to start with, add my water to emulsify and start massaging it into my scalp. As I do this, I can tell if I need more or not. A good way to tell if you're using enough product is to either use a good quality comb (never a brush on wet hair) or use your fingers as a comb, running it through your hair while you have the CC in. If you see a nice "line" of product on the ridge of the comb (or on your fingers), then you're using enough. If you're brushing out globs of CC, then you can probably cut back on the amount you're using. Your hair can only "accept" so much CC, and while it's very important to use enough product, there's no sense in being wasteful.
